Managing Director leading enterprise organizational development and change initiatives at Cigna. Partnering with senior leaders to drive effectiveness, high performance, and change adoption across the organization.
Responsibilities
Serve as a strategic advisor on organizational effectiveness, organizational design, culture, change readiness, and stakeholder engagement to senior HR Business Partners and executive leaders.
Develop and execute integrated organizational development and change management strategies aligned with enterprise goals to drive business outcomes.
Lead the design and implementation of complex OD interventions (e.g., organizational design, culture transformation, team effectiveness).
Develop and execute comprehensive change strategies aligned with enterprise talent strategy priorities and critical business initiatives, working with key partners to manage decision-making, risk mitigation, and project delivery accordingly.
Assess and manage change saturation and readiness across the enterprise portfolio, elevating critical risks and mitigation strategies to senior leadership.
Bolster and lead a high-performing internal consulting practice that partners with business and HR leaders to diagnose organizational needs, design tailored OD and change interventions and deliver measurable business outcomes.
Coach and mentor team members to build expertise in needs assessment, systems thinking, consulting, and strategic thinking while supporting career growth and development.
Define clear goals and performance metrics for the team, ensuring alignment with enterprise priorities and client needs.
Establish a consulting center of excellence, promoting best practices, knowledge sharing, and continuous improvement across the team and with key matrix partners.
Continue to refine existing OD methodologies and resources, aligning to current best practices and business needs.
Establish and scale enterprise-wide change management methodologies and resources, in partnership with Leadership Development and Learning teams.
Build internal OD and change capability across HR and business units through training, coaching, and knowledge-sharing.
Facilitate executive team interventions and design sessions to address organizational health, engagement, and performance.
Partner with executive sponsors, business leaders, and project teams to assess change impacts, drive alignment and readiness, and develop tailored change plans.
Design and execute communication strategies that foster transparency, engagement, and alignment across all levels of the organization.
Facilitate leadership alignment sessions, employee forums, and feedback loops to ensure inclusive and responsive change efforts.
Partner with talent analytics to define KPIs and leverage advanced analytics, dashboards, and digital tools to monitor organizational health and change adoption.
Use data-driven insights to refine OD and change strategies and ensure sustained outcomes.
Conduct post-implementation reviews and lessons-learned sessions to inform future initiatives.
Requirements
Advanced degree in Organizational Development, Industrial/Organizational Psychology, or related field
10+ years of progressive Human Resources leadership experience, including significant experience in OD, change management and transformation
Demonstrated ability to build and lead high-performing consulting teams
Experience in both change management and OD within large, complex, matrixed organizations
Deep expertise in OD theory and practice (e.g., systems thinking, group dynamics, culture transformation, leadership assessment) and leading OD interventions at-scale.
Proven success in leading enterprise-wide, large-scale, complex change initiatives in a global, matrixed organization is required.
Certification in OD (e.g., organizational design, team effectiveness tools), change management methodologies (e.g., PROSCI, ADKAR, Kotter) highly desirable.
Strong business acumen, strategic thinking, and stakeholder management skills.
